amazonka-redshift-1.3.7: gen/Network/AWS/Redshift/RotateEncryptionKey.hs
{-# LANGUAGE DeriveDataTypeable #-}
{-# LANGUAGE DeriveGeneric #-}
{-# LANGUAGE OverloadedStrings #-}
{-# LANGUAGE RecordWildCards #-}
{-# LANGUAGE TypeFamilies #-}
{-# OPTIONS_GHC -fno-warn-unused-imports #-}
{-# OPTIONS_GHC -fno-warn-unused-binds #-}
{-# OPTIONS_GHC -fno-warn-unused-matches #-}
-- Derived from AWS service descriptions, licensed under Apache 2.0.
-- |
-- Module : Network.AWS.Redshift.RotateEncryptionKey
-- Copyright : (c) 2013-2015 Brendan Hay
-- License : Mozilla Public License, v. 2.0.
-- Maintainer : Brendan Hay <brendan.g.hay@gmail.com>
-- Stability : auto-generated
-- Portability : non-portable (GHC extensions)
--
-- Rotates the encryption keys for a cluster.
--
-- /See:/ <http://docs.aws.amazon.com/redshift/latest/APIReference/API_RotateEncryptionKey.html AWS API Reference> for RotateEncryptionKey.
module Network.AWS.Redshift.RotateEncryptionKey
(
-- * Creating a Request
rotateEncryptionKey
, RotateEncryptionKey
-- * Request Lenses
, rekClusterIdentifier
-- * Destructuring the Response
, rotateEncryptionKeyResponse
, RotateEncryptionKeyResponse
-- * Response Lenses
, rekrsCluster
, rekrsResponseStatus
) where
import Network.AWS.Lens
import Network.AWS.Prelude
import Network.AWS.Redshift.Types
import Network.AWS.Redshift.Types.Product
import Network.AWS.Request
import Network.AWS.Response
-- |
--
-- /See:/ 'rotateEncryptionKey' smart constructor.
newtype RotateEncryptionKey = RotateEncryptionKey'
{ _rekClusterIdentifier :: Text
} deriving (Eq,Read,Show,Data,Typeable,Generic)
-- | Creates a value of 'RotateEncryptionKey' with the minimum fields required to make a request.
--
-- Use one of the following lenses to modify other fields as desired:
--
-- * 'rekClusterIdentifier'
rotateEncryptionKey
:: Text -- ^ 'rekClusterIdentifier'
-> RotateEncryptionKey
rotateEncryptionKey pClusterIdentifier_ =
RotateEncryptionKey'
{ _rekClusterIdentifier = pClusterIdentifier_
}
-- | The unique identifier of the cluster that you want to rotate the
-- encryption keys for.
--
-- Constraints: Must be the name of valid cluster that has encryption
-- enabled.
rekClusterIdentifier :: Lens' RotateEncryptionKey Text
rekClusterIdentifier = lens _rekClusterIdentifier (\ s a -> s{_rekClusterIdentifier = a});
instance AWSRequest RotateEncryptionKey where
type Rs RotateEncryptionKey =
RotateEncryptionKeyResponse
request = postQuery redshift
response
= receiveXMLWrapper "RotateEncryptionKeyResult"
(\ s h x ->
RotateEncryptionKeyResponse' <$>
(x .@? "Cluster") <*> (pure (fromEnum s)))
instance ToHeaders RotateEncryptionKey where
toHeaders = const mempty
instance ToPath RotateEncryptionKey where
toPath = const "/"
instance ToQuery RotateEncryptionKey where
toQuery RotateEncryptionKey'{..}
= mconcat
["Action" =: ("RotateEncryptionKey" :: ByteString),
"Version" =: ("2012-12-01" :: ByteString),
"ClusterIdentifier" =: _rekClusterIdentifier]
-- | /See:/ 'rotateEncryptionKeyResponse' smart constructor.
data RotateEncryptionKeyResponse = RotateEncryptionKeyResponse'
{ _rekrsCluster :: !(Maybe Cluster)
, _rekrsResponseStatus :: !Int
} deriving (Eq,Read,Show,Data,Typeable,Generic)
-- | Creates a value of 'RotateEncryptionKeyResponse' with the minimum fields required to make a request.
--
-- Use one of the following lenses to modify other fields as desired:
--
-- * 'rekrsCluster'
--
-- * 'rekrsResponseStatus'
rotateEncryptionKeyResponse
:: Int -- ^ 'rekrsResponseStatus'
-> RotateEncryptionKeyResponse
rotateEncryptionKeyResponse pResponseStatus_ =
RotateEncryptionKeyResponse'
{ _rekrsCluster = Nothing
, _rekrsResponseStatus = pResponseStatus_
}
-- | Undocumented member.
rekrsCluster :: Lens' RotateEncryptionKeyResponse (Maybe Cluster)
rekrsCluster = lens _rekrsCluster (\ s a -> s{_rekrsCluster = a});
-- | The response status code.
rekrsResponseStatus :: Lens' RotateEncryptionKeyResponse Int
rekrsResponseStatus = lens _rekrsResponseStatus (\ s a -> s{_rekrsResponseStatus = a});
